Serving our campus community
JBU sees the Walton Lifetime Health Complex as an investment in both the health and quality of life for our students, faculty and staff. We seek to provide service, accessible hours, fitness classes, and top-of-the line facilities and equipment for the benefit of our campus community and their families.

All traditional undergraduate, graduate and online students automatically receive a free membership to the Walton Lifetime Health Complex. Dual-enrollment students are not eligible for free WLHC membership.
Spouses and dependents* of full-time students enrolled at JBU are eligible to receive a discounted student family membership.
*Eligible dependents must be 22 years or under to be included in the student family membership.
All employees of JBU, including current adjuncts, automatically receive a free membership to the Walton Lifetime Health Complex.
Spouses and dependents* of full-time employees are eligible to receive a free membership to the WLHC.
Spouses and dependents* of part-time employees are eligible to receive a discounted family household membership. (Part-time status defined as working less than 1000 hours/year.)
*Eligible dependents must be 22 years or younger to be included in the employee household membership.
Employees retiring from JBU, and their spouses, are eligible for free full-use memberships to the Walton Lifetime Health Complex. Eligibility is verified through JBU’s Human Resources department.

John Brown University is a leading private Christian university, training students to honor God and serve others since 1919. Arkansas’ top-ranked university (The Wall Street Journal) and top-ranked regional university (U.S. News), JBU enrolls more than 2,200 students from 37 states and 42 countries in its traditional undergraduate, graduate, online and concurrent education programs. JBU offers more than 50 undergraduate majors, with top programs including nursing, psychology, construction management, graphic design, family and human services, and engineering. Eighteen graduate degrees are available in business, counseling, cybersecurity, and education.
